Influence of Composition on Shape Memory Characteristics of Ti-Ni-Cu Alloy Fabricated by Pulse-Current Pressure Sintering Method

Abstract
This paper aims to find out the influence of composition on shape memory characteristic of Ti-Ni-Cu alloy fabricated by pulse-current pressure sintering method. In the case of Ti powder, the solution-treatment results in decreasing in relative density. On the other hand, in the case of TiH_2 powder, the solution-treatment results in increasing in relative density, but decreasing in tensile strength and elongation. The increase in Ni equivalent value made the transformation temperatures lower.
